Customer Navigator
Description We are looking for a dedicated Customer Navigator to join our team on a contract basis in Palo Alto, California. In this role, you will act as a non-clinical liaison, ensuring that patients and their families receive exceptional support before, during, and after their healthcare encounters. This position requires a strong commitment to delivering outstanding service aligned with patient-centered care principles. Responsibilities: • Serve as a concierge and primary point of contact for patients, addressing their needs and concerns throughout their healthcare journey. • Assist patients and visitors with transportation arrangements, including providing information on campus shuttles and other transportation options. • Facilitate the scheduling of medical appointments and coordinate care plans for both inpatient and outpatient services. • Actively communicate patient feedback and concerns to the appropriate departments, ensuring timely resolution and follow-up. • Maintain compliance with safety, quality, and ethical standards in alignment with organizational and regulatory requirements. • Provide detailed information and guidance to patients navigating the healthcare system, ensuring they feel supported and informed. • Utilize organizational tools and templates to maintain accurate records and streamline communication. • Participate in ongoing training and education programs to enhance service delivery and patient experience. • Collaborate with team members to sustain compliance with National Patient Safety Goals and other healthcare standards. • Uphold confidentiality and professionalism in all interactions, fostering trust and respect among patients and colleagues. Requirements • Proven experience in customer service, public relations, or a similar role, preferably in a healthcare setting. • Strong interpersonal and communication skills with a focus on empathy and professionalism. •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ite, including Word and Excel, and familiarity with scheduling tools. • Ability to manage multiple tasks effectively while adhering to deadlines and quality standards. • Knowledge of healthcare systems and practices, including patient care coordination. • Commitment to maintaining confidentiality and adhering to ethical standards. • Team-oriented mindset with the ability to work collaboratively in a diverse environment. • Fluency in English and excellent verbal and written communication skills.
